The war launched by Russia against Ukraine continues to cause shock waves in the world of sport. The day after the recommendation of the International Olympic Committee (IOC) to exclude Russian and Belarusian athletes from international competitions, the International Automobile Federation (FIA) announced the holding of an extraordinary World Council this Tuesday, March 1.
It is neither more nor less than the President of the FIA elected in December, Mohammed Ben Sulayem, who announced it on his Twitter account Monday evening. “ An extraordinary meeting of the World Motor Sport Council will be convened tomorrow (Tuesday) to discuss issues relating to the ongoing crisis in Ukraine, indicates the FIA press release. Further updates will be given after the meeting. »

The FIA being a federation recognized by the IOC since 2012, the prospect of no longer seeing drivers/co-drivers/teams of Russian or Belarusian nationality in motor competitions is very real. Monday, February 28, the Ukrainian Automobile Federation had already requested the exclusion of Russian drivers from the FIA.
For example, the fate of the pilot from the Motherland, Nikita mazepin, within the stable Haas en Formula 1 could be sealed following the decision of the world council.
THEEndurance is a particularly attractive discipline for Russians. G-Drive (the commercial name of the fuel distributed by the oil company Gazprom) is a team that has been running LM P2 races for a decade, and has just signed Daniil Kvyat for the 2022 season of the World Endurance Championship (WEC). Moreover, the publication of the official list of entrants to the 24 Hours of Le Mans has been postponed, officially “for administrative reasons”.
